This weekend, we celebrate Pentecost, often called the birthday of the Church. Jesus refers to the Holy Spirit as the “Advocate.” The Latin word for lawyer is “advocatus.” Like a lawyer, the Holy Spirit defends and guides us. So, when you’re in trouble, don’t forget — ask for your lawyer, and do what he tells you. See you at Mass!

This weekend, we celebrate The Ascension of the Lord which marks the day Jesus' earthly ministry ended, and his heavenly ministry began. Christ's ministry continues to this day at the right hand of the Father in Heaven.
